Abstract

This research is to find out the use of casual speech style that used by the male workers in "Sejahtera Motor" garage.the writer is curious to know about casual speech style because it is one of the types of speech that is used in daily interaction when the speaker is not paying attention to the choice of word and sentence structure. There are four characteristics of casual speech style; ellipsis, slang, swearword, and code mixing. All of them occasionally occur in informal background. In this research, the researcher wants to investigate about how are the characteristics of casual style used in male conversation. She uses some theories of style from Holmes (2001), Martin Joos (1976), Huddlestone (1976), Geertz (1959), Liedlich (1973). In collecting the data, the writer recorded the conversation in two days when the worker had a breaktime and then she transcribed it so that the writer could analyze it. Furthermore, the writer finds out that Ellipsis mostly occur in the workers conversation because it happens in context of relax situation. Additionally, trough this research the writer found that the workers commonly mix upJavanese code and English code.
